So Its time for a long deserved update on this whole situation .... sorry for the delay but my Yaris was in the shop for 4 weeks and then all the holidays happened and then vacation lol

The total damages where over $6,000 !! the major things that got fixed/replaced where:
-new oil pan
-new fronted/bumper
-4 new steelies
-2 new tires (front)
-new front right control arm
and a host of little pieces that got bent/went missing in the accident

The Rental Versa treated me ok ..... id never buy one but it was decent to drive .... i did put almost 3,000 miles on it in 3 weeks :D

Thanks for all the well wishes everybody :D I finally have my baby back and in near perfect condition :D
